About Walker Percy

Walker Percy (May 28 1916 – May 10 1990) was an American Southern author whose interests included philosophy and semiotics.

Additional quotes by Walker Percy

Where does one start with a theory of man if the theory of man as an organism in an environment doesn't work and all the attributes of man which were accepted in the old modern age are now called into question: his soul, mind, freedom, will, Godlikeness?
There is only one place to start: the place where man's singularity is there for all to see and cannot be called into question, even in a new age in which everything else is in dispute.
That singularity is language...
